临城手机软件外包流程 (临城手机软件外包流程)

作者:双鸭山麻将开发公司 阅读:20 次 发布时间:2023-08-07 01:37:06

摘要:临城手机软件外包流程是一种高效的软件开发方式,本文将详细介绍这种流程的具体步骤。从明确需求、拟定合同、项目规划、软件开发、测试验证等多个方面进行讲解,让读者了解这种流程的特点和优势,为企业的软件开发提供指导和参考。1. 明确需求,为软件开发打下基础为了高效完成软件开发,首先要做的就是明确...

  临城手机软件外包流程是一种高效的软件开发方式,本文将详细介绍这种流程的具体步骤。从明确需求、拟定合同、项目规划、软件开发、测试验证等多个方面进行讲解,让读者了解这种流程的特点和优势,为企业的软件开发提供指导和参考。

临城手机软件外包流程 (临城手机软件外包流程)

  1. 明确需求,为软件开发打下基础

  为了高效完成软件开发,首先要做的就是明确需求。这个过程要根据客户的要求和目标需求的特点,进行细致的分析和梳理,进而打下需求分析的基础。同时,这个阶段还要和客户进行深入的交流和沟通,促使双方对软件的需求达成共识。

  2. 拟定合同,明确责任和权利

  在完成需求分析后,企业需要与客户签订合同。合同要详细说明软件开发的范围、价钱、时间、保密条款、法律责任等,明确责任和权利,避免出现纠纷。同时,本阶段也要注意在合同中规定软件的质量标准,以及防止未来可能的变更与追加规定。

  3. 项目规划,确立软件开发的时间节点

  项目规划的主要目的是为软件开发全过程制定一个详细的计划。这个计划应该包括软件开发的时间表、人员分配、开发阶段的任务、需求分析阶段的分析、测试的计划等,需要各方面进行协调和评估,确保如期完成整个软件开发过程。

  4. 软件开发,确保质量和效率

  软件开发阶段是整个流程的核心阶段,包括需求分析、设计、编码、测试等多个环节。在开发过程中要确保严格按照合同要求进行开发,并按照时间节点逐步完成开发过程,同时尽可能保证代码的可维护性和可读性。在这个过程中要建立严格的考核机制和质量管理体系,每次开发更新都需要进行测试和验证,确保软件质量和效率。

  5. 测试验证,确保产品质量

  软件开发阶段结束后,需要进行测试和验证。测试的目的是确认软件是否符合要求,并发现潜在的错误和问题。测试还要检查软件的安全性、可靠性、稳定性和性能,确保软件符合客户要求和合同标准。在验证过程中,需要注意对客户的反馈和意见进行搜集和加以改进,并全方位进行考核和评估,确保软件质量和效率。

  总体来说,临城手机软件外包流程是一种高效的软件开发方式,可以帮助企业在软件开发的各个方面提高质量和效率,避免过多沉没成本。同时,企业在执行软件外包流程时需要各个方面进行协调和考虑,确保实现最大效益。希望本文能够为企业的软件开发提供指导和参考。

  随着移动互联网的普及,手机软件外包已经成为企业中越来越流行的一种方式。尤其对于小型企业而言,通过外包的方式来完成软件开发任务,既可以降低成本,又可以节约时间,提高生产效率。但是,如何才能高效完成临城手机软件外包流程呢?本文将从需求分析、 UI 设计、编码和测试四个方面详细介绍临城手机软件外包流程,并分享一些提高外包效率的经验和技巧。

  1、需求分析

  需求分析是临城手机软件外包流程中最基础、最重要的步骤之一。在需求分析的过程中,需求工程师需要和客户充分沟通,了解用户需求,为软件开发的后续工作提供基础。因此,在需求分析的过程中,需要注意以下事项:

  1.1明确项目目标:

  在进行需求分析之前,需要明确项目的目标和功能。项目目标和功能的清晰获取有利于后续的开发工作,可以查明所需技术栈和开发周期等基础信息,提前做好准备工作,从而减少工作时间和成本。

  1.2注重详细描述:

  需求分析的过程中,需求工程师需要尽可能详细地描述项目的功能、流程、界面、用户操作场景等,方便后续的开发工作。此外,需求工程师还需要为开发人员提供足够的用户需求背景,让开发人员了解用户的要求和期望,便于开发出符合客户要求的软件。

  1.3计划变更测试:

  软件开发是一个复杂的过程,可能存在需求变更的情况。因此,在需求分析的过程中,需要考虑到需求的变更情况,并在计划中对需求变更进行测试。

  2、UI 设计

  UI 设计是临城手机软件外包流程中比较核心的一环节。在 UI 设计的过程中,需要注意以下事项:

  2.1切换清楚时序:

  UI 设计的过程中,需要先进行原型设计,然后再进行测试和迭代等工作。因此,需要注意界面设计的规范性、美观性和实用性等方面因素。同时,设计需要切换清楚时序,让开发人员明确明次任务开展时间点。

  2.2注重可用性和交互:

  在 UI 设计的过程中,需要注重软件的可用性和交互设计,这可提高软件的用户体验和用户留存率。在设计中应考虑到用户的使用习惯,确保按钮布置、颜色搭配等方面符合用户的预期,易于使用。

  2.3文件描述清楚:

  UI 设计的过程中,需要对设计文件进行详细描述,包括注释、功能、界面、色彩搭配等方面,避免造成开发人员理解困难。

  3、编码

  编码是实现临城手机软件外包流程的关键流程。编码的过程中需要注重以下要素:

  3.1妥善处理接口:

  编码的过程中,需要注重数据的处理,并能妥善处理数据接口。同时需要遵循常规编程范式,如 MVC架构模式、IoC容器设计模式等。这些设计模式不仅提高代码的健壮性,而且可以减少重复的劳动和修改的时间,提高软件开发效率。

  3.2注重代码质量:

  编码过程中,需要注意代码的风格,注重代码质量,同时注重代码的合理性和简洁性。这样不仅提高代码的可读性和可维护性,而且节省了开发人员的时间和精力,提高了代码的可靠性。

  3.3注重安全性:

  编码过程中,需要十分注重软件的安全性,避免出现信息泄露等安全问题。为此,需要中度过程中配合测试人员进行漏洞检测,避免出现安全隐患。

  4、测试

  测试是临城手机软件外包流程的最终步骤。测试人员的工作是通过各种测试方式发现软件中的 Bug,从而提高软件的的可靠性和安全性。在测试的过程中,需要注意以下要素:

  4.1需求回归:

  在测试过程中,需要拉取并将测试人员与付出人员共同回溯需求,以鲜明需求的个数,测试人员在设计用例的过程中,避免无法被置信的测试方案错误。

  4.2注重用例设计:

  测试用例设计是验证软件功能和性能的关键环节。在测试的过程中,需要注重用例设计,确保用例的完整性和覆盖率。测试人员还需要注重对不同的测试环境进行测试,以发现软件的各种问题,为软件改进提供依据。

  4.3注重安全性:

  测试过程中,需要注重软件的安全性,测试人员需要针对各种安全问题进行测试,如程序漏洞、信息泄露等,以确保软件的安全性和可靠性。同时,测试人员认真对待测试结果,并及时反馈 Bug问题。在测试结果分析过程中,同时应该要将日常数据重构,依着性能、稳定性、安全性、数据等标准将问题分类、处理,依据分类结果提出相关解决方案。

  以上即是关于临城手机软件外包流程详解:如何高效完成软件开发的总结,通过关注需求分析、 UI 设计、编码和测试几个重要环节,可以让整个软件外包流程更加流畅、高效、顺畅,提高外包效率和减少开发成本,从而让客户更加满意。

  • 原标题:临城手机软件外包流程 (临城手机软件外包流程)

  • 本文链接:https:////qpzx/302692.html

  • 本文由双鸭山麻将开发公司飞扬众网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部